About One slice lemon cake

This One Slice Lemon Cake is a delightful treat with origins rooted in classic European baking, especially popular in British and French cuisine. Made with a harmonious blend of flour, sugar, eggs, butter, and freshly squeezed lemon juice, this moist cake is infused with the tangy zest of lemons. Often topped with a light lemon glaze, it balances sweetness and tartness for a refreshing flavor. While rich in flavor, it’s moderate in portion size, making it a sensible indulgence. The use of lemons provides a natural source of vitamin C, and its small serving size helps manage calorie intake compared to larger desserts. However, it contains added sugars and fats, which should be enjoyed in moderation as part of a balanced diet. Perfect for savoring with tea or coffee, this slice offers a little indulgence with a burst of citrus brightness.
